About the role
This is a full-time, 36 hour/week, day shift position. The Registered Nurse - Clinical Educator role is responsible for the implementation of clinical and non-clinical education. Develops, coordinates, and implements continuing education and in-service education for all clinical departments.
Requirements
- Graduate of an accredited School of Nursing; BSN required.
- Master’s Degree in Nursing or related field preferred.
- Current applicable state(s) license as a Registered Professional Nurse.
- Current BLS certification required or must obtain within 30 days of start date.
- Demonstrated clinical expertise in direct patient care as normally acquired through a minimum of two years clinical experience and meets all the care delivery expectations of the expert clinical nurse within their clinical setting required.
- Experience in classroom instruction and/or clinical teaching associated with specialty specific setting preferred.
